Councillors Zafal Iqbal and Mohammed Shafiq says businesses have been reluctant to invest in Bradford due to the high crime rate TWO Bradford councillors are trying to convince businesses to invest in Bradford after they claim that the high crime rate is causing reluctance from some firms to invest in the area. Cllr Zafar Iqbal (Lab, Bradford Moor) said: There are many people who love our district and want to invest in our ward which is good and welcoming news. When people invest in our area this provide local jobs for local people and helps our economy. Cllr Iqbal said: People are hesitant about opening businesses and keep asking about level of crime in the area.
